Failure really can be an asset if what you're trying to do is improve, learn, or do something new.

(0 Reviews)

Failure should be viewed not merely as a setback but as a valuable opportunity for growth and betterment. When facing challenges, our responses and lessons learned can lead to significant personal development. Embracing failures allows us to gain insights that propel us forward in our endeavors, transforming obstacles into pathways for success.

Ryan Holiday in his book "The Obstacle Is the Way" emphasizes the importance of perspective in the face of adversity. He suggests that by reframing our understanding of failure as a stepping stone to improvement, we can harness our experiences for innovation and learning. This approach underscores the idea that adversity can actually serve as a catalyst for achieving our goals.
